The Crypt is a huge repository for the ancient dead. The air is chill and fetid, the walls cold and damp. Bones are strewn liberally everywhere and every noise echoes worryingly, violating the overbearing silence of the grave.

This branch is unusually silent: sounds travel farther here.

The entrance to this branch can be found between levels 2 and 3 of the Vaults.

This branch is 3 levels deep.

This branch contains the entrance to the Tomb.

These stairs lead to an ancient crypt. Unfortunately, not everything that was buried there had the decency to stay dead.

Crypt entry.png The Crypt is a 3-floor branch, found between the Vaults:2 and 3. It is filled with all manner of undead opponents, and although it does not contain a rune of Zot, it does hold the mummy-guarded entrance to the Tomb, as well as a significant amount of treasure guarded by powerful undead foes on the final floor.

Layout

The Crypt is made up of claustrophobic, winding hallways and large open chambers, all of which are built of undiggable stone or metal walls.

The Crypt is also a very silent place, so noise carries farther than usual. Most residents are dead quiet, but even the noise made by your weapons will attract attention.

Crypt:3

The third floor of the Crypt always has a treasure vault, which can be sized anywhere from a modest room to all of the map. These always contain some of the most powerful undead enemies in the game, but often hold living and golem opponents as well.

Some of the treasure vault loot will be Necromancy themed loot, such as draining, vampiric, or pain-branded weapons, rings of positive energy, the Necronomicon, staves of death, or one of several similarly themed unrands.

Strategy

Crypt is almost entirely filled with undead creatures, so holy wrath and Dispel Undead are more useful here. Likewise, negative energy and torment are common, so bring rN+.
